							Obituary  
							 
							Lois Leesman, 102, of 
							Lincoln, IL, passed away on Wednesday, October 29, 
							2025, at St. Clara’s Rehab and Senior Care. 
							 
							Lois was born April 2, 1923, in Lincoln, the 
							daughter of Harrison and Blanch (Hoblit) Wilson. She 
							was united in marriage to Marvin Leesman on October 
							2, 1948. He preceded her in death in 2006. 
							 
							Lois is survived by her two sons, Keith (Charlise) 
							and Thomas Kevin; grandchildren, Jonathan (Dana) 
							Leesman and Jeff (Jennifer) Leesman; 
							great-grandchildren, Keegan, Cade, Norah, Jenna, 
							Tate, and Jeris; along with numerous nieces and 
							nephews. 
							 
							A member of the Lincoln First Presbyterian Church 
							for ninety-eight years, she served as Deacon, Elder, 
							and Clerk of Session and was active in Women’s 
							Association activities. Lois was a 49-year member of 
							the Abraham Lincoln Chapter of D.A.R. 
							 
							She attended Lincoln Elementary Schools and was a 
							1941 LCHS graduate. Lois then received a business 
							certificate from Lincoln College and in 1942, 
							started working in the office of Remington Rand, 
							INC. in Illiopolis, IL, where ammunition was made 
							during WWII. Then in 1944, she moved to Burbank, CA, 
							and worked at Lockheed Aircraft until the war was 
							over in 1946. She later worked for the State of 
							Illinois, retiring from LDC in 1990.   | 
							
							 
					
					  
							Lois and Marvin loved 
							to dance and went many places over the years to 
							enjoy the music. Lois’ greatest joys were being with 
							her family, especially her grandchildren and 
							great-grandchildren, and living in her home (which 
							Marvin built) until she turned 100 years old. 
							 
							She was preceded in death by her parents, husband, 
							one brother, and two sisters.
